Rapid eye movement sleep rem sleep or rems is a unique phase of sleep in mammals and birds, distinguishable by randomrapid movement of the eyes, accompanied with low muscle tone throughout the body, and the propensity of the sleeper to dream vividly the rem phase is also known as paradoxical sleep ps and sometimes desynchronized sleep because of physiological similarities to waking. He is the director and founder of the stanford university sleep disorders clinic and research center, the worlds first sleep disorders center. He is also coeditor of the definitive textbook, principles and practice of sleep medicine. Dement describes the journey to sleep in his book,the. In 1975 he launched the american sleep disorders association and served as president for its first twelve years. He is a leading authority on sleep, sleep deprivation and the diagnosis and treatment of sleep disorders such as sleep apnea and narcolepsy. Ever since the discovery by aserinsky and kleitman in 1953 of the relation between dreaming and the electrophysiological measures derived from the electroencephalogram and electrooculogram, a small band of scientists has pursued the search for the functional links between the cognitive and neurophysiological characteristics of dreaming sleep.
